Moda Operandi unveils new site

Published
Apr 14, 2015

The first online luxury retailer to provide consumers access to full designer collections straight from the runway unveiled a new website on Monday, featuring bolder images, exclusive videos and editorials in an immersive onscreen experience.

Moda Operandi

 
Deborah Nicodemus, CEO of Moda Operandi, said, "We're changing the way consumers interact and engage online. Five years ago consumers were browsing luxury online. Today online has proven to be a powerful and profitable channel for luxury e-commerce.  It is critical that shoppers feel as confident purchasing luxury brands online as they do offline.”

The redesigned website includes a new search functionality, optimized load times, enhanced personalization options, and the ability to shop in multiple currencies.

Moda Operandi


"We differentiate ourselves by being able to bring our customer a shoppable runway before anyone else. It's a highly distinguished and romantic shopping experience," said Keiron McCammon, CTO of Moda Operandi. 

The website’s redesign follows the company’s recent $60 Million Series E round of funding and the company’s acquisition of San Francisco-based ModeWalk, the fashion website that allows personal stylists to connect with their clients using on-line tools.
